本書采用GD32F303ZET6芯片的GD32F3蘋果派開發(fā)板,重點(diǎn)介紹FreeRTOS操作系統(tǒng)的原理與應(yīng)用開發(fā)。全書共19章,前兩章簡要介紹了嵌入式操作系統(tǒng)和GD32F3蘋果派開發(fā)板;第3~19章分別介紹基準(zhǔn)工程的創(chuàng)建、簡易操作系統(tǒng)的實(shí)現(xiàn),以及FreeRTOS的移植、任務(wù)管理、時(shí)間管理、消息隊(duì)列、二值信號量與計(jì)數(shù)信號
"本書秉承“新工科”理念,從科研、教學(xué)和工程實(shí)際應(yīng)用出發(fā),理論聯(lián)系實(shí)際,全面系統(tǒng)地講述基于STM32CubeMX和HAL庫的嵌入式系統(tǒng)設(shè)計(jì)與應(yīng)用實(shí)例。STM32CubeMX是ST公司提供的用于STM32開發(fā)的免費(fèi)工具軟件,是STM32Cube生態(tài)系統(tǒng)的核心工具軟件。本書從市場上暢銷的STM32F1系列微控制器入手,利用
"本書秉承“新工科”理念,從科研、教學(xué)和工程實(shí)際應(yīng)用出發(fā),理論聯(lián)系實(shí)際,全面系統(tǒng)地講述基于STM32CubeMX、STM32CubeIDE和HAL庫的嵌入式系統(tǒng)設(shè)計(jì)與應(yīng)用實(shí)例。STM32CubeMX和STM32CubeIDE是ST公司提供的用于STM32開發(fā)的免費(fèi)工具軟件,是STM32Cube生態(tài)系統(tǒng)的核心工具軟件。本
《XilinxFPGA工程師成長手記》以Xilinx公司的FPGA為開發(fā)平臺,以VerilogHDL、SystemVerilog、VHDL和Vivado為開發(fā)工具,詳細(xì)介紹FPGA常用接口的實(shí)現(xiàn)方法,并通過大量實(shí)例,分析FPGA實(shí)現(xiàn)過程中的具體技術(shù)細(xì)節(jié)!禭ilinxFPGA工程師成長手記》提供相關(guān)實(shí)例的源碼文件和配套
全書分為3篇。第1篇存儲基本原理和分布式基本原理。特別針對LinuxOS的IO知識進(jìn)行講解,并且還會結(jié)合Go的存儲編程實(shí)現(xiàn)。第二篇剖析現(xiàn)有的存儲系統(tǒng)實(shí)現(xiàn),對它們使用的設(shè)計(jì),概念,實(shí)現(xiàn)進(jìn)行深入的剖析。以此來借鑒。第三篇進(jìn)行編程實(shí)戰(zhàn),將編寫數(shù)個(gè)極具實(shí)踐價(jià)值的應(yīng)用程序,并且形成一個(gè)完備的分布式存儲系統(tǒng)。
本書基于西門子S7-1200型PLC實(shí)訓(xùn)設(shè)備,講解PLC的入門知識、編程基礎(chǔ)、基本指令、通信方法等,對實(shí)訓(xùn)平臺的操作、博途軟件的使用、觸摸屏的組態(tài)及伺服驅(qū)動(dòng)的接線與參數(shù)設(shè)置等進(jìn)行了流程梳理及講解。全書分為知識庫和技能庫兩大部分,并配有工作頁,用于學(xué)生實(shí)訓(xùn)。本書可作為職業(yè)院校相關(guān)專業(yè)的教材,也可作為企業(yè)培訓(xùn)教材。
本書以Linux發(fā)行版本Ubuntu為平臺,用項(xiàng)目教學(xué)的方式進(jìn)行介紹。全書共五個(gè)項(xiàng)目,分別介紹了嵌入式系統(tǒng)、計(jì)算器項(xiàng)目的設(shè)計(jì)與實(shí)現(xiàn)、基于ZigBee傳輸技術(shù)的無線QQ項(xiàng)目設(shè)計(jì)、基于STM32的溫濕度監(jiān)測系統(tǒng),以及基于NB-IoT技術(shù)的智慧消防系統(tǒng)設(shè)計(jì)(課程實(shí)踐部分),其中,項(xiàng)目一到項(xiàng)目四著重訓(xùn)練基礎(chǔ),項(xiàng)目五為課程的綜合
本書深入淺出地介紹了如何從零開始一步步設(shè)計(jì)出一個(gè)入門級的CPU,以及在這個(gè)過程中應(yīng)該掌握哪些知識、遵守哪些設(shè)計(jì)原則、規(guī)避哪些設(shè)計(jì)風(fēng)險(xiǎn)、可以使用哪些開發(fā)技巧。全書從邏輯上分為三個(gè)部分,第一部分(第1-3章)介紹產(chǎn)業(yè)界進(jìn)行CPU研發(fā)的過程以及本地與遠(yuǎn)程FPGA實(shí)驗(yàn)平臺、FPGA上板實(shí)現(xiàn)、Verilog應(yīng)用實(shí)例等CPU設(shè)計(jì)中
本書以意法半導(dǎo)體公司新推出的基于ArmCortex-M0+的STM32G071MCU為硬件平臺,以意法半導(dǎo)體公司的STM32CubeMX和Arm公司的KeilμVision(Arm版本)集成開發(fā)環(huán)境(以下簡稱Keil)為軟件平臺,以Cortex-M0+處理器結(jié)構(gòu)、高級微控制總線結(jié)構(gòu)、Cortex-M0+處理器指令集和應(yīng)
本書主要介紹RISC-V體系結(jié)構(gòu)的相關(guān)內(nèi)容。本書主要內(nèi)容包括RISC-V體系結(jié)構(gòu)基礎(chǔ)知識以及香山處理器微架構(gòu)實(shí)現(xiàn),如何使用QEMU以及香山模擬器NEMU來搭建實(shí)驗(yàn)環(huán)境,RV64指令集中常見指令使用以及常見陷阱,RISC-V函數(shù)調(diào)用規(guī)范、棧布局,GNU匯編器的語法、常見偽指令、RISC-V依賴特性,鏈接器的使用、鏈接腳本